With Funding In Tow, Uniiverse Launches A Platform For Collaborative Living

Screen shot 2012-02-07 at 7.51.23 PMYou have to love the accelerated development cycle that spins so fast in the tech industry's echo chamber. Just as most Americans are starting to get comfortable with this whole "social revolution," the tech industry has already exhausted every inch of "Social" (and social networking) to the degree that most are now tired of hearing about social. Case-in-point: A startup launching today, called Uniiverse, begins its pitch with this simple message, "Uniiverse is not a social network." I advised co-founders Craig Follett, Ben Raffi and Adam Meghji to put that bit in caplocks going forward. That's part of the reason Uniiverse is resistant to being lumped in with social networks, as the Canadian startup is building an online platform that focuses on bringing value to our offline lives.
